Description

The table contains for each animal the number of teeth in each major grouping. This is Table 9.1 in Chapter 9 of Hartigan (1975) on page 170.

Format

A data frame with 66 observations on the following 9 variables.

name

a character vector for the name of the animal

top.i

a numeric vector for the number of top incisors

bottom.i

a numeric vector for the number of bottom incisors

top.c

a numeric vector for the number of top canines

bottom.c

a numeric vector for the number of bottom canines

top.pm

a numeric vector for the the number of top premolars

bottom.pm

a numeric vector for the number of bottom premolars

top.m

a numeric vector for the number of top molars

bottom.m

a numeric vector for the number of bottom molars

Details

Hartigan uses this table to illustrate a tree-leader algorithm.
